Molecular Neuroscience
Molecular Neuroscience delves into the study of the molecular mechanisms underlying the structure and function of the nervous system. This field focuses on understanding how individual molecules within neurons and glia contribute to various neurological processes, including synaptic transmission, signal transduction, gene expression, and neuroplasticity. Researchers in Molecular Neuroscience investigate how alterations in these molecular pathways can lead to neurological disorders such as Alzheimer's disease, Parkinson's disease, and epilepsy. By elucidating the intricate molecular interactions within the brain, scientists aim to develop new therapeutic strategies for treating and preventing neurological conditions.
